Ashton Soul was made to be the perfect data processor for the alien Kha'Tahn. As such, he can sense and even disrupt--painfully--their processes. He wcould probably pick out Flickerflame, even in an animal form, in a pack of other animals---by sensing those nanites.

Each Next Leveller has their own specialized nanites; like a breeder of rare flowers or of dogs, each "strain" was designed to make humans better servants....for them.  Ageless' nanites control the aging process in her and those close to her. Attractive's can increase the cohesion between molecules.  Vigilant's enhance the senses by projecting the small field that can shift his sight and hearing beyond the human eye and ear's limits.

But Ashton can disrupt ANY of them.
